The Mosaic Company (NYSE: MOS) is the world’s leading integrated producer of concentrated phosphate and potash—two of the three most important nutrients in agriculture. We employ more than 13,000 people in six countries to serve farmers all over the world. Our Headquarters is in Lithia, Florida with operations throughout North America (U.S./Canada) and South America.

TURNAROUND PLANNER LEAD

Where will you work: The selected candidate/employee will work primarily out of our corporate office located in Fishhawk, FL (13830 Circa Crossing Drive, Lithia, FL 33547) but will occasionally assist onsite at several other locations (i.e., Bartow, New Wales, Riverview).

Schedule: General work hours are 7am-4:30pm with every other Friday off (9/80 schedule).

This is a centralized, multi-site position to coordinate activities for the safe, on budget and on time execution of Turnarounds within the North American business to ensure assets are fit for safe and reliable service. The individual must manage the Turnaround workflow planning process, job scope development, bidding process, and maintain specific knowledge of plant assets.

What will you do?

  • Lead the turnaround planning effort with multiple stakeholders.
  • Responsible to coordinate with operations, maintenance, E&I, EHS, engineering, and project managers to develop a comprehensive work scope and define effective turnaround plans.
  • Liaise with Procurement to manage the creation of relevant contractor bid documents.
  • Maintain the turnaround worklist, once approved.
  • Work with other stakeholders, including the turnaround scheduler, on critical path identification, contractor resourcing, material coordination, site preparation, logistic planning, and verify timelines on related jobs.
  • Provide detailed job plans, identifying parts, tools, and resources required to execute turnaround work in a safe, cost-effective manner.
  • This role will require site visits to develop plans.
  • During execution of turnaround work plan, this position is required to check the progress of the job plans and modify plans as needed.
  • Provide feedback from the execution and strive to continuously improve future job plans and scopes based on that feedback.
  • Document base plans for future turnaround planning development, continually refining and sharing across sites.
  • Develop standardized processes and work packages for future turnarounds.
  • Develop detailed work scope packages and facilitate site meetings with stakeholders to include Operations, Maintenance, Reliability, Capital, Contractors, and Purchasing group to deliver bid packages for work to be completed by approved crafts and contractors.
  • Provide turnaround scheduler with job scope and time frames to build detailed schedule pre-turnaround and communicate changes in job plans during execution of turnaround to keep scheduler informed of changes needed.
  • Assist in the development of plot plan to identify staging areas for contractors, parts, equipment and environmental waste control.
  • Responsible for safety and environmental performance of associated Mosaic personnel and contractors.
  • Perform miscellaneous other job-related duties as assigned.

What do you need for this role?

  • High school diploma/GED is required along with 7 years of r elevant industrial maintenance planning and/or electrical - instrumentation experience ; OR associate degree (or better) along with 5 years of r elevant industrial maintenance planning and/or electrical - instrumentation experience .
  • Technical knowledge of Maintenance Principles.
  • Proficiency in plant equipment and maintenance standards.
  • Influential communication skills, ability to get results through others.
  • Anal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Strong organizational skills in a fast-paced industrial environment are required.
  • High attention to detail.
  • Knowledge of EHS programs and policies.
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ite,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S) – ( SAP, PI, OIS is preferred).
